// Client setup for the Streetwise autocomplete widget.
// This instantiates the suggestion client against our internal
// GeoHint resolver rather than the public endpoint, since the
// widget needs access to unreleased locality data for the
// Brindlewood pilot. Requests are rate-limited per key, and the
// resolver rejects anything without a valid credential attached.
// The key for the staging resolver is included directly below.

gateway credential: kto3_qfe

Subject: Quickstore 4.2 — bloom filter now fronts the KV layer

Plugin authors: starting with this release, Quickstore places a bloom filter ahead of the key-value store. Negative lookups return faster; false positives fall through safely. No API changes are required on your side. Verify your plugin against the staging build referenced below.

session token of fahif-tadup = htk3_9c7

## Formula sandbox tuning

User-supplied formulas in Gridmoor execute inside a restricted interpreter with hard ceilings on time, memory, and call depth. Reviewers should confirm any change to these ceilings is justified in the PR description, since raising them widens the abuse surface. Defaults were chosen from production traces. The current limits are as follows.

limits module of tafog-fawip:
WEIGHTS = {
    "julix": 57,
    "lamys": 992,
    "kasvan": 209,
    "quenok": 750,
    "alddor": 259,
    "oliath": 1009,
    "wenix": 815,
}

Runbook: Account recovery for SeedSmith

If a teammate gets locked out of the SeedSmith test-data factory admin panel, don't panic — it happens about once a month. First, confirm their identity on a quick call, then reset their session via the Fablegen console. If the console itself is locked, you'll need to reopen the maintenance account. For that, use the passphrase that follows.

strongbox words: norwyn-wenael-aldvan-aldiel-wendor-holael

Ticket: FIELD-2281 — Expired credentials blocking offline sync

For the weekly sync: the Heronpath field-survey app's offline mode stopped reconciling on Monday because the cached sync token expired while crews were out of coverage. Surveys queued locally are intact, but uploads fail silently until re-auth. We've extended token lifetime to 30 days and reissued credentials. The replacement key for the internal sync service follows.

service key, fafog-fahaf: vxb3-x55